Last Call: When a Serial Killer Stalked Queer New York (2023–) takes us back to the early 1990s, a time when homophobia and hate crimes were rampant, and the AIDS crisis was escalating. In the midst of this harrowing backdrop, a chilling narrative unfolds as a serial killer targets gay men in New York City.

The unknown murderer cunningly infiltrates the vibrant queer nightlife scene, using it as a hunting ground for his victims. The film navigates the dark underbelly of the city's LGBTQ+ community, shedding light on the vulnerability and fear experienced by its members during this tumultuous period.

Last Call delves into the lives of those affected by the killer's reign of terror, offering a poignant exploration of the impact on the victims' friends, families, and the community as a whole. It provides an intimate and emotional portrayal of their struggles, capturing the range of emotions they experience - from anger and grief to resilience and hope.

The tragic case of teen mother, Nicola Payne, who at 18 years old went missing and was never heard from again. This limited series tells the extraordinary story through gripping first-hand testimony from Nicola's heartbroken family and friends, as well as the lead police detectives who carried out the investigation - still one of Britain's largest unsolved murder cases. The series examines all the evidence, highlights key failings in the original work of the police and uncovers shocking new revelations. Will this documentary be the springboard to solving this 30-year investigation once and for all?

Crazy drivers kill innocent people on Danish roads every year. To combat life-threatening behavior in traffic, the police have been given a new tool: the insanity clause. With it in hand, the police now have the opportunity to punish Denmark's most dangerous drivers much more severely than before. Unconditional revocation of the driver's license, confiscation of the vehicle and imprisonment await road users who commit the worst offences.
